NORWAY’S KING HOSPITALISED IN LANGKAWI ISLAND WHILE HOLIDAYING IN MALAYSIA

King Harald V of Norway was on 27 February hospitalised on the Malaysian island of Langkawi while holidaying in the Southeast Asian nation, reportedly due to an infection, which has since forced the 87-year-old monarch to remain in the hospital despite a reported improving health. The king is expected to stay at the hospital for a few more days, according to the Norwegian Royal Palace, but it is not yet known when exactly he will be returning to Norway.
